Angela, an officer with the Wildlife and Parks Department, writes a proposal to urge the city council not to develop an area of nearby wetlands. Which approach from Angela's proposal demonstrates the use of ethos?

a. She provides statistics about the relationship between wetland destruction and animal population.
b. She demonstrates how she conducted quality research and considered alternative perspectives.
c. She discusses the birds that rely on the wetlands to nest and raise their young.
d. She defines wetlands in terms that are easy to understand.

Final answer:

Angela demonstrates the use of ethos by showing that she has conducted quality research and considered various perspectives, establishing her credibility. Option B is correct.

Step-by-step explanation:

An approach from Angela's proposal that demonstrates the use of ethos would be option b: She demonstrates how she conducted quality research and considered alternative perspectives. Ethos pertains to the credibility or ethical appeal of the speaker or writer, suggesting trustworthiness and authority on the subject matter. By showing that she has conducted thorough research and considered various viewpoints, Angela establishes herself as a knowledgeable and ethical authority on the issue of wetland conservation.

The other options, such as providing statistics (logos) or discussing the birds (pathos), involve logical evidence and emotional appeal, respectively, and do not directly relate to the writer's credibility or ethical appeal.
